What Are YouTube Placement Ads?

YouTube placement ads are a type of ad format available through Google Ads that allows content creators to display their ads on specific YouTube videos or channels. These ads can appear as mid-roll ads, which are placed in longer videos at natural breaks, or as overlay ads, which are small, semi-transparent ads that complement the content without overshadowing it. By choosing the right ad format and strategically placing ads in relevant YouTube videos, content creators can effectively reach their target audience and maximize their ad revenue potential. Measuring the Success of Your YouTube Placement Ads

Measuring the success of your YouTube placement ads is crucial for understanding the performance and effectiveness of your ad campaigns. Here are some key metrics to consider:

  • View Rates: The view rate measures the percentage of viewers who watched your ad compared to the number of impressions. A high view rate indicates that your ad is engaging and attracting viewers.
  • Click-through Rates (CTR): The CTR measures the percentage of viewers who clicked on your ad compared to the number of impressions. A high CTR indicates that your ad is compelling and enticing viewers to take action.
  • Conversion Rates: The conversion rate measures the percentage of viewers who complete a desired action, such as making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ter, after viewing your ad. This metric indicates the effectiveness of your ad in driving conversions.
  • Cost Per Acquisition (CPA): The CPA measures the cost of acquiring a customer through your ad campaign. This metric helps you evaluate the efficiency and profitability of your ad spend.
  • Return on Investment (ROI): The ROI measures the profitability of your ad campaign by comparing the revenue generated from your ads to the cost of running the campaign. A positive ROI indicates that your ad campaign is generating a profit.

By analyzing these metrics and making data-driven decisions, you can optimize your YouTube placement ads for better performance and results.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Do I Select the Best Placements for My Ads?

To select the best placements for your ads, consider the following factors: relevancy to your video content, potential viewership, and engagement metrics. Utilize placement targeting in Google Ads to choose specific YouTube videos or channels that align with your target audience and objectives.

Can I Use Placement Ads for Brand Awareness Campaigns?

Yes, placement ads can be used for brand awareness campaigns on YouTube. By targeting broader audience segments and utilizing display campaigns, you can increase the visibility of your brand and reach a wider audience on the platform.

What Should I Do If My Ads Aren’t Getting Enough Views?

If your ads aren't getting enough views, consider optimizing your targeting, ad content, and placement selection. Conduct keyword research, refine your audience targeting, and experiment with different ad formats and placements to increase visibility and engagement.

How Can I Optimize My Ads for Different Devices?

To optimize your ads for different devices, ensure that your ad content is responsive and compatible with various screen sizes. Test your ads on different devices and adjust the visuals and formatting as needed to provide a seamless viewing experience.

Is There a Way to Track the Direct ROI of Placement Ads?

Yes, you can track the direct ROI of placement ads by utilizing Google Ads' analytics and conversion tracking features. Set up conversion tracking and monitor the performance of your ads to understand the revenue generated directly from your placement ads.
